A little bit more

Persian, female cat, Luna, is looking for a forever home. This sweet, grey, 8 year, 8 month old girl has become available for adoption because her elderly owner, who lived alone, has recently moved into residential care.


Luna arrived into HFC foster care in Wonersh two weeks’ ago, and after initially being a little shy, she has adapted beautifully to her new environment. She follows her Foster Carer from room to room, curling up on her desk whilst she works and sleeping on a pillow next to her at night. Luna has become very affectionate and been happy to be picked up by her Carer. She has also been friendly and sociable around quiet visitors.


Luna adores company and would benefit from being adopted by adults who spend the majority of their time at home. She becomes timid around other animals and would prefer a home where she can enjoy being an only pet.


Luna’s lovely long coat requires daily brushing to keep it in good condition and free of painful matting. She loves to spend time outside and would like a home with safe, outside space of her own.


Prior to coming into HFC care, Luna was spayed, microchipped and received a booster vaccination and she is now ready to meet potential adopters.
